Head to head by decade
| Decade | Namibia | United States |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 0.7764 | 0 | 0.7764 | Namibia |
| 1990s | 5.59 | 0 | 5.59 | Namibia |
| 2000s | 0.9564 | 0 | 0.9564 | Namibia |
| 2010s | 0 | 0 | 0 | β |
| 2020s | 0 | 0.0007 | 0.0007 | United States |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
